Abstract

The utility model discloses a kind of cloud terminal device for being used for industrial Internet of Things, including power module, main control module, RS485 communication modules, GPRS module and mixed-media network modules mixed-media;Wherein, the main control module is mainly made of processor, and serial ports expansion built in processor at least forms RS485 communication module interfaces all the way, and serial ports all the way built in processor forms GPRS module interface, and the serial port-shaped all the way built in processor is into network module interface;The power module is connected with main control module, to provide power supply for the work of processor;The RS485 communication modules are used to access data acquisition equipment, to receive the data that data acquisition equipment is collected;The GPRS module is used to be received the data that data upload to photovoltaic cloud platform and transmitted for receiving photovoltaic cloud platform;The mixed-media network modules mixed-media is used to access in local network.The utility model is used for the cloud terminal device not only better performances, and the security of data transmission and privacy are all higher of industrial Internet of Things.

Embodiment
In the following, with reference to attached drawing and embodiment, the utility model is described further:
As shown in fig.1, for the structure diagram of the cloud terminal device provided by the embodiment for being used for industrial Internet of Things, such as scheme Shown in 2-6, the equipment is mainly by power module 20, main control module 10, RS485 communication modules 30, GPRS module 40 and network Module 50 is formed.The power module is connected with main control module, and power supply is provided with the work of the processor for main control module; RS485 communication modules are used to access data acquisition equipment, to receive the data that data acquisition equipment is collected;GPRS module The data for uploading to photovoltaic cloud platform for being received data and being transmitted for receiving photovoltaic cloud platform;Mixed-media network modules mixed-media For accessing in local network.
Specifically, which is mainly made of Crotex-M3 microprocessors, the built-in string of Crotex-M3 microprocessors Mouth extension two-way forms RS485 communication module interfaces, that is to say, that and RS485 communication modules are provided with two interfaces, specifically, The RS485 modules are using the combination of balance driver and differential receiver, anti-common mode interference ability enhancing, i.e. antinoise Interference is good;Meanwhile RS485 module maximum transmission distances standard value is 4000 feet (about 1219 meters), actually up to 3000 Rice, RS485 module interfaces are to allow to connect up to 128 transceivers in bus, i.e., with multistation ability, such user can Easily to set up device network using single RS485 module interfaces.

When this cloud terminal device is specifically used, more header boxs, inverter, rings are accessed in RS485 communication module interfaces The data acquisition equipments such as border monitoring, these data acquisition equipments gather power station current power by Modbus rtu protocols, add up Generated energy, CO2Emission reduction, income, operating status etc. data are into this cloud terminal device, and then this cloud terminal device passes through GPRS module uploads to the real time data collected in photovoltaic cloud platform and is counted and handled, photovoltaic cloud platform to data into Go after the completion of counting and handling, then related data is sent in this cloud terminal device.Simultaneously as this cloud terminal device is set There is mixed-media network modules mixed-media, can be linked into local network, the monitoring device in local network network diagram can be whole by modbusTCP and cloud End communication obtains real time data, that is to say, that can be connected by the mixed-media network modules mixed-media interface that cloud terminal device provides with local computing The real time data after being counted and handled in photovoltaic cloud platform can be obtained by Modbus TCP agreements by connecing, and change speech It, cloud terminal device only for data acquisition and transmission one passage is provided, can greatly improve data transmission security with Privacy.Certainly, it is necessary to which explanation, above-mentioned photovoltaic cloud platform and data acquisition equipment are that the general of this area is set It is standby, therefore, just no longer its specific configuration and operation principle are described in detail in the present embodiment.
It follows that the cloud terminal device of the application supports Remote configuration and monitoring, cloud terminal can remotely be gathered Data and operating condition are monitored in real time.Cloud terminal device carries the function of active reporting, the data collected can be led to GPRS module active reporting is crossed to cloud server end.This cloud terminal device provides a variety of PORT COMs at the same time, there is RS458 moulds respectively Block interface, mixed-media network modules mixed-media interface, GPRS module interface, realize serial communication, network communication and wireless telecommunications.Meanwhile this cloud Terminal device also supports remote management and the firmware upgrade of photovoltaic cloud platform.
Preferably, this cloud terminal device further includes a data storage module 60 to one kind as this implementation, for preserving Data received by GPRS module, to realize the backup of data, prevent the loss of data.
